The “Eleventh Five-Year” project of Guangzhou Machinery Institute passed the acceptance

The total project of the “Key Basic Components and General Parts” project of the “Eleventh Five-Year” National Science and Technology Support Program jointly undertaken by the Guangzhou Institute of Machinery Science and the Hefei General Machinery Research Institute, as well as four sub-topics and three results, recently passed the expert group. Acceptance and identification. The expert group believes that through the implementation of the project, not only has opened up a research and development and production processing technology for low-cost, high-performance sealed products for hydroelectric, coal, metallurgy, nuclear power and other related industries, but also marks a major advanced machinery in China. Major breakthroughs have been made in the technology of key sealing elements.
This project is mainly aimed at supporting the needs of large-scale hydro-generating units, coal mining machinery, metallurgical equipment, and nuclear power equipment. Research has been conducted on seal theory, materials, structures, manufacturing processes, quality control, and performance testing to form a finite element auxiliary seal. Structural optimization, elastic compensation design of sealing structure, large non-die seal ring turning machining, constant low friction and pressure resistant ultra-large PTFE combined sealing processing, super-large seal performance testing and high-performance nuclear main pump mechanical seal six core technology. During the implementation of the project, a high-performance hydraulic turbine generator set, coal mine hydraulic support, and AGC cylinder combination seals were developed, industrialization demonstration bases were established, and good economic benefits were achieved; 17 national patents were applied, including invention patents. Items, published 23 papers; at the same time, the development of three corporate standards and internal technical specification documents 4.
In particular, the three innovative achievements of the project are of great significance to the realization of the localization of major key components such as large-scale hydro-generator units, large-scale fully-mechanized coal mining machinery, and large-scale metallurgical equipment. The high-performance major equipment rubber and plastic seals developed by this project have reached the level of imported similar products with comprehensive performance and service life. The technology is at the leading domestic level, and some of the technologies have filled the domestic gap and have achieved significant economic and social benefits.
